      "question": "Does the NFC tag affect wine quality or storage?",
      "answer": "No. NFC tags are completely passive (no battery, no emissions) and are constructed from food-safe materials. The tag does not interact with the wine in any way and is safe for use in contact with capsules and closures. Operating temperature range (−25 to +85 °C) covers all normal wine storage and shipping conditions."

      "question": "Can consumers read the tag through the foil capsule?",
      "answer": "It depends on the capsule material. Standard tin or aluminium foil capsules block NFC signals. For NFC-enabled capsules, use PVC, polylaminate or paper-based capsule materials, or position the tag on top of the capsule where it is exposed.       "question": "What happens when the tamper loop breaks?",
      "answer": "The NTAG 424 DNA chip permanently records the tamper event in its CTTES (Counter Tamper Tamper Event Status) register. Every subsequent NFC tap reports 'tampered / opened' status in the SUN authentication URL. This is irreversible: even if someone attempts to repair the physical break or re-adhere the capsule, the digital tamper flag remains set."

      "question": "Can the NFC bottle tag support per-vintage, per-cuvée or per-bottling-lot data?",
      "answer": "Yes. We support per-order AES-128 key diversification (one master key per SKU with unique per-tag sub-keys, per NXP AN10922 CMAC-AES key-diversification guidance) and per-order encoding of vintage, appellation, cuvée name, bottling date, cask / barrel number and lot identifier into the tag's NDEF payload. For high-volume bottlings (e.g. 200,000 bottles of a Champagne non-vintage cuvée) we deliver an encrypted UID-to-data CSV plus SUN / SDM pre-computed URL templates that your verification backend imports directly — no per-bottle write step is required on your bottling line. For ultra-premium per-vintage / per-cask programmes (Burgundy en-primeur, single-cask Scotch, vintage Cognac) we support per-lot key rollover with quarterly / annual key rotation so each vintage's authentication proof is cryptographically independent."

      "question": "How does the NFC bottle tag support EU wine traceability and the upcoming Digital Product Passport (DPP)?",
      "answer": "EU wine traceability is governed by Regulation (EU) 2018/273 (authorisations, movement certificates, cellar register VI-1 / VI-2) and Regulation (EU) 1169/2011 on consumer-facing information, with the recent Delegated Regulation (EU) 2019/33 adding mandatory ingredient and nutrition disclosure for wines sold in the EU from 8 December 2023. The NFC tag's linked provenance page can host the full 1169/2011 disclosure (ingredients, allergens, nutrition declaration, energy value) with automatic consumer-language localisation — replacing or supplementing the crowded physical back label. On the DPP horizon, the EU Ecodesign for Sustainable Products Regulation (ESPR 2024/1781) is phasing in mandatory digital product passport requirements across product categories; premium beverages are expected to be in later tranches. NTAG 424 DNA tags today are forward-compatible with GS1 Digital Link URI syntax (the DPP transport layer the Commission has signalled it will standardise on), so a wine authentication programme deployed in 2026 can be extended into DPP compliance when the wine-sector implementing act lands, without re-tagging the inventory."
